Change creates action. If you take a magnet and wave it around next to a wire, the changing magnetic field will violently push the electrons in that wire, creating an electric current. This single rule is how 99% of the electricity powering your house right now is generated.

Electromagnetic theory is a branch of physics that deals with the study of the interactions between electrically charged particles and the electromagnetic force, one of the four fundamental forces of nature. It describes how electrically charged particles interact with each other and with the electromagnetic field, which is a physical field that permeates all of space and is created by the interaction of electrically charged particles. 🏛️ Part 2: The Four Commandments (Maxwell’s Equations

Your charging pad has a coil of wire with a changing electric current running through it. This creates a changing magnetic field. You place your phone on top; the phone's internal coil catches that changing magnetic field and transforms it back into electric current to fill your battery (Thanks, Faraday's Law!). What is LaTeX?

LaTeX is widely used by scientists, engineers, and students for its powerful and reliable way of typesetting mathematical formulas. Instead of manually adjusting symbols, subscripts, or fractions—as in typical word processors—LaTeX lets you write formulas using simple commands, and the system renders them beautifully (like in textbooks or academic journals).

Formulas can be embedded inline or displayed separately, numbered, and referenced anywhere in the document. This is why LaTeX has become the standard for theses, research papers, textbooks, and any material where precision and readability of mathematical notation matter.

Why doesn't LaTeX paste directly into Word?

Microsoft Word doesn't understand LaTeX syntax. If you simply copy code like \frac{a+b}{c} or \sqrt{x^2 + y^2} into a Word document, it will appear as plain text—without fractions, roots, or superscripts/subscripts.

To display formulas correctly, you'd need to either manually rebuild them using Word's built-in equation editor—or use a tool like my converter, which automatically transforms LaTeX into a format Word can understand.
